**The big picture**:
Have your career take off with us As a Personal Concierge with our Owner Services team, you are dedicated to providing outstanding customer service through proactively raising Owners’ trip requests, and ensuring these bookings are accurate, customized, and communicated. Once a trip becomes active, the focus of this role shifts to monitoring, communicating, and responding to client needs.
Our team of Personal Concierges enthusiastically demonstrate AirSprint’s corporate value of Service in everything they do. With a passion for aviation and a professional, customer service-centric attitude, strong skills like communication, organization, a high attention to detail, and the ability to listen actively enables our team to build professional relationships and gain a robust understanding of Owners’ preferences. The Personal Concierge role is essential in enabling our team to go above and beyond, working collaboratively to create exceptional, tailored customer experiences to all of our Owners each time they fly with us.

**In this role you will**:

- Accurately respond to client travel needs, ensuring all trip details and preferences are communicated and loaded into the flight scheduling software.
- Proactively arrange Owners’ requests for ground logistics, such as catering, transportation, expediting of unaccompanied goods, passenger mobility aids, etc.
- Proactively arrange Owners’ in-flight requests, such as cabin service attendant, level of cabin service, cabin configurations, special commissary, or any other service add-ons and special requests.
- Provide exceptional customer service to AirSprint’s high-end clientele; building strong, professional relationships in order to better anticipate and understand our Owners’ needs.
- Conduct quality control checks for ground logistics, in-flight requests, and trip details.

**About us**:
A passion for aviation and providing exceptional service formed the foundation of AirSprint's introduction of Fractional Jet Ownership to Canada in 2000. Today, each of our dedicated staff is passionate about delivering a private aviation experience that positively contributes to successful Canadians' personal and professional lives. We do this with values of "Safety, Service, People, Integrity, Humility, and Community."

AirSprint's mission is to provide successful Canadians with a better choice for optimizing their time by enhancing the private jet ownership experience with industry-leading safety standards, exceptional turn-key service, and increased flexibility, all at a fraction of the cost and personalized for their individual needs.
